Selecting the Right Work Gloves

Hands are essential for a wide variety of tasks, but they can easily become injured if not properly protected. That's where work gloves come in! They offer crucial defense against cuts, punctures, abrasions, and other hazards you might encounter on the job.

Choosing the right pair depends on the specific nature of work you do. A construction worker will need gloves with substantial protection against impact and sharp objects, while a gardener might prefer lightweight gloves that offer flexibility.

Here's a comprehensive guide to help you choose the perfect work gloves for your needs:

  • Consider the activities you'll be carrying out.
  • Identify potential hazards you might be exposed to.
  • Investigate different types of gloves and their materials.
  • Fit the gloves for a snug feel.

By following these tips, you can locate work gloves that provide optimal safety and improve your efficiency on the job.

Protecting Your Hands: A Comparison of Glove Materials

When selecting gloves for your hands, the fabric is vital. Each type of material grants unique characteristics that affect its performance in various situations. Leather, known for its durability, is an excellent choice for demanding tasks. Synthetic materials like nitrile are often favored for their fluid resistance.

Cotton, on the other hand, is a air-permeable option appropriate for everyday use.

Finally, the best glove material for you rests on your individual needs and the jobs at hand.
